Abstract

The title compound [Fe 2(CO) 6(μ-Ph 2N 2)] ( 1) was obtained in a two-step sequence from Fe 2(CO) 9 and phenyl azide via the intermediate tetraazadiene complex (CO) 3Fe·Ph 2N 4 ( 2). Its NN bond length (1.41 åA) is 0.04 åA longer than that in [Fe 2(CO) 6(μ-Et 2N 2)] corresponding to an enhanced reactivity. Accordingly, the reactions of 1 with CO and H 2 which lead to [Fe 2(CO) 6(μ-PhN-CO-NPh)] ( 4) and [Fe 2(CO) 6( > -NHPh) 2] ( 5) respectively, involve cleavage of the NN bond.
